Many Savings From LED Bulbs
Tuesday July 17, 2012 2:59am

Illumination from light emitting diodes has become one of the most desired means of conserving energy for so many people in recent years. LED bulbs have many features that make them perfect for so many different projects. Their versatility in style and their long operating times contribute greatly to their efficiency.

While they do cost more to purchase than traditional bulbs, they last longer and consume less energy, thereby making them the much better value in the long run. They are created in a wide variety of styles, including those that can fit into many current sockets and fixtures. Compatibility means that it is a simple matter to replace all the old incandescent lights with the more efficient choices.

Utilization costs are so much lower with these products. In regular incandescent lights, one that is labeled as 40 watts will actually draw that much power per hour of operation. In contrast, the LED unit will only pull between five and seven per 60 minutes of use. This becomes a rather impressive savings in a very short period of time.

Lower replacement costs is yet another way that this type of lamp proves its worth. Some of them can operate for as long as 50,000 hours, which far exceeds the life of other lights. The parts inside the bulb are stiffly supported to decrease the risk of damage from impact or vibration. Since they are not made of glass, they are considerably stronger then their much more fragile counterparts.

There is no flickering delay in illumination. The diodes always light quickly without spark or sputter. Since they contain no mercury and no lead, they are much better for the environment when time comes to dispose of them.

A traditional light source contributes to higher energy costs. They generate a lot of extra heat when powered on, which warms a room up a few degrees from each bulb operating. This means the AC unit is likely to have to run more often to compensate for the rise in temperature, thereby raising the cooling bill. A more efficient LED will put out approximately 90% less warmth than the others.

There are big differences in the way each type of resource uses the energy they take in. An LED will use at least 80% of that power to productively generate illumination. A traditional bulb will only use 20% of the electricity consumed for light, the rest is spent creating heat. This is why they are hot to the touch, and pose a threat of serious burns if touched before they have been allowed to cool down for quite some time.

Another factor that makes the LED item so desired in a lot of products is that they can be designed to emit colors without the need for gels or films. This is a benefit because they save the energy normally dispelled by regular white light sources in pushing through the tinted overlays. The brighter hues are what makes them such a big draw in specialized projects.

LED bulbs have a compact style and versatility that allows them to be used in so many different ways. They are becoming more popular in products such as traffic signals, exit signs, flashlights, headlights, holiday lights and even garden illuminations. It is their low heat output that has made them so attractive to art studios and stage productions.
